Klappentext 'A hilarious insight into the everyday heroics of firefighter who put their lives on the line for us all'Russell BrandWARNING: MAY CONTAIN CATS UP TREES Leigh Hosy-Pickett has seen it all in his twenty-five years as a firefighter. He's battled infernos and pulled people from the wreckage of twisted metal but the closest he ever came to death was at the hands of a confused hen do. Now he's here to tell us the funniest, most eye-opening and moving stories from a life lived amongst the smoke. From blazes involving sex toys, to navigating cannabis farm security measures, this brilliantly warm and entertaining book by a third-generation firefighter is a celebration of the everyday heroism of our Fire Service. But it is also a clear-eyed and honest record of the many sacrifices made in the line of duty and the consequences of that heroism. About the author

Leigh Hosy-Pickett is a third-generation firefighter and the author of UP IN SMOKE: My True Story of Life as a Firefighter.

Leigh has a Chief Fire Officers' Commendation for 'Action & Dedication Beyond the Call of Duty'. He won two gold medals at the 2008 World Firefighter Games and also climbed to the summit of Mt Kilimanjaro, Tanzania, in aid of The Fire Fighters Charity. He is a campaigner, activist, mental health advocate, public speaker and House Music DJ.
